Default Login & Address Book

I've successfully installed RoundCube and it's working on my website. However, one thing is not:

When you get to the login page for WebMail there are three fields: 'Username', 'Password', and 'Server'. I want Server to be automatically assigned.

I've followed the instructions and done this:
$rcmail_config['default_host'] = 'localhost';

My config file even looks just like this, but the 'Server' field is still showing up and is still unpopulated. What do I do to make this work?

Thanks for any and all help.
